How Bierang works with dark and light backgrounds in digital ads

Contrast matters — especially in feed-based ads where thumbnails auto-play or pause mid-scroll. I tested Bierang across five background treatments: white, charcoal, soft peach, deep navy, and textured cream. It held up best on light-to-mid tones — its thin weight gains presence without needing heavy outlines or shadows. On dark backgrounds, I kept line height generous (1.6x) and avoided tight tracking. Bonus: the included OpenType ligatures added subtle polish to double letters (“ff,” “fi,” “fl”) — small details that signal craft, not clutter. As a Script Handwritten option, it’s refined enough for premium positioning but never stiff.

Bierang for Email Banners and Landing Page Headers

Your email banner has ~0.8 seconds to earn a scroll. Your landing page header has ~1.2 seconds to earn a pause. That’s why I use Bierang only for *primary display text* — never body copy, never long subheads. Think: “Your First Workshop Starts Friday” or “Limited Spots — Save Your Seat.” Short. Scannable. Human. Because Bierang is a Fonts asset designed for impact, not endurance, it pairs beautifully with neutral sans serifs (like Manrope or Sora) for supporting text. The contrast between its delicate script and crisp geometric structure creates instant hierarchy — no extra styling needed.

What to check before using Bierang in client or commercial projects

Before dropping Bierang into a client deck or ad set, I always verify: file formats (OTF + WOFF for web), included weights (it’s a single-weight display font — perfect for headlines, not paragraphs), language support (Latin-based, including accented characters), and commercial licensing (yes — full rights for digital ads, templates, merch, and client deliverables). No hidden restrictions. No surprise fees. As a Fonts purchase, it’s lean, focused, and ready for real work — not just mood boards.
